Absorbency and Leak Protection
For me, absorbency is one of the biggest deciding factors. I want a diaper that can hold up through naps, car rides, and nighttime without leaks. In my experience, Member’s Mark diapers are generally designed to provide solid absorption for daily use. I would still recommend testing them during the time of day when your child usually has the heaviest wetting, especially if you need overnight protection.
Fit and Comfort
A diaper can have great absorbency, but if the fit is off, it will still fail. I looked for a snug but not tight fit around the legs and waist. Member’s Mark diapers are usually a good value for parents who want a straightforward fit for routine wear. If your child has thicker thighs or is between sizes, I would consider sizing up to reduce the chance of leaks or red marks.
Softness and Skin Feel
I always pay attention to how soft a diaper feels because my baby’s skin is sensitive. Member’s Mark diapers aim to offer a comfortable feel for everyday use, and that matters to me when choosing a bulk diaper option. If your child has very sensitive skin, I would still watch for irritation during the first few wears before stocking up.
